McCONNELL, JENNIFER LYNN, 41, of High Street, Dedham, Mass., died Tuesday, May 19, 2009 in Newton-Wellesley Hospital after a long illness.
She was born Aug. 21, 1967 in Providence and was a 1985 graduate of Coventry High School. She was the daughter of Dr. Raymond and Mrs. Marilynn (Cook) McConnell of Damariscotta, Maine, who ran a longtime dental practice in West Warwick.
Jennifer is survived by her husband, Anthony Piscitelli of Dedham, and she was the devoted mother of a beautiful daughter, Alexandra Piscitelli, age 6.
Jennifer is also survived by a sister, Elizabeth Lee McConnell Byrne of Quincy, Mass., two brothers, Michael of Concord Township, Maine and Matthew of Honolulu, Hawaii, and by numerous a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ces and nephews.
Jennifer graduated from St. Anselm College in 1989 and New York Chiropractic College in 1994. She was employed by Parexel International in Waltham. She was beloved by many friends and co-workers.
